Solution for (x-1)(x+1)=x^2+1 equation:


Simplifying
(x + -1)(x + 1) = x2 + 1

Reorder the terms:
(-1 + x)(x + 1) = x2 + 1

Reorder the terms:
(-1 + x)(1 + x) = x2 + 1

Multiply (-1 + x) * (1 + x)
(-1(1 + x) + x(1 + x)) = x2 + 1
((1 * -1 + x * -1) + x(1 + x)) = x2 + 1
((-1 + -1x) + x(1 + x)) = x2 + 1
(-1 + -1x + (1 * x + x * x)) = x2 + 1
(-1 + -1x + (1x + x2)) = x2 + 1

Combine like terms: -1x + 1x = 0
(-1 + 0 + x2) = x2 + 1
(-1 + x2) = x2 + 1

Reorder the terms:
-1 + x2 = 1 + x2

Add '-1x2' to each side of the equation.
-1 + x2 + -1x2 = 1 + x2 + -1x2

Combine like terms: x2 + -1x2 = 0
-1 + 0 = 1 + x2 + -1x2
-1 = 1 + x2 + -1x2

Combine like terms: x2 + -1x2 = 0
-1 = 1 + 0
-1 = 1

Solving
-1 = 1

Couldn't find a variable to solve for.

This equation is invalid, the left and right sides are not equal, therefore there is no solution.
